A noun is a term that typically serves as the name for a particular object or group of objects, including live things, locations, events, traits, states of existence, and concepts. The abstract noun refers to qualities like kindness and love. In contrast, uncountable nouns are those that are incapable of counting. These nouns are not limited to just objects like dust or stars. Feelings like love cannot be counted as well. Thus, love is both an abstract and uncountable noun.
